Output 24fa9b668477d03fef2b692e887c660fe5ef15fb4717925202142515bd01b15a:2

value
17430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e49f846c9c9684d4a899f8e63e5e768cc21f32 OP_EQUAL
address
39cTv44hWyJc1ZQyT8LicQXMwEksQqmtuC
transaction
24fa9b668477d03fef2b692e887c660fe5ef15fb4717925202142515bd01b15a
spent
true